What Drives Stellar Web Page Design Today?
Contemporary web design encompasses more than just visual appeal; it's a delicate fusion of creativity and technical precision. At its core, effective website design online focuses on creating an intuitive, accessible, and engaging experience for the user.
Consider the foundational elements:
- Adaptive Design: With over 60% of global website traffic coming from mobile devices, a responsive design is non-negotiable. This means your web pages dynamically adjust to various device dimensions, from desktop monitors to tablets and smartphones.
- Visitor Journey: This involves understanding how users interact with your site. A great UX ensures visitors can easily find what they're looking for, complete tasks without frustration, and enjoy their overall visit. Leading UX research firms, such as the Nielsen Norman Group, have provided exhaustive empirical studies on how well-structured content and logical pathways are paramount for user retention.
- Guided Attention: Guiding the user's eye through the most important elements on a page is key. This is achieved through strategic use of size, color, contrast, and spacing. Web design standards advocated by industry leaders, including insights often discussed by European design agencies and platforms dedicated to digital education like Online Khadamate, consistently emphasize this principle as fundamental to readability and conversion.
- Performance Optimization: Slow-loading websites are a major deterrent. Key metrics like Google's Core Web Vitals now play a significant role in SEO performance, making site speed a critical design consideration. Efficient image compression, strategic caching, and streamlined code bases are effective methods.

Measuring Success: Benchmarking and Data-Driven Design
Understanding how your website performs is crucial for continuous improvement. Comparing against competitors and leveraging internal statistics provides critical perspectives.
Key Performance Indicators (KPIs) to Monitor|Essential Metrics to Track}:- Goal Completion Rate: The proportion of users who fulfill a predefined objective (e.g., transaction, registration, inquiry form submission).
- Bounce Rate: The proportion of visits where users leave after viewing only one page. A elevated bounce rates frequently signal issues with initial appeal or content alignment.
- Engagement Time: How the average duration of user interactions.
- Page Load Time: The speed at which your web content becomes visible. Improving this, a frequent recommendation from tools like Google PageSpeed Insights and specialized performance services, is absolutely essential.
